Where we stop and your bookkeeper starts

We handle the technical layer: install, versions, multi-user, the file, backups, performance, and connecting it to your other systems. Chart of accounts, categorization, reconciliation and tax treatment belong to your bookkeeper or CPA.

When we find something that looks like an accounting problem, we tell you and hand it to them. Guessing at that costs you more than the setup did.

The two problems we see most

The company file lives on somebody's desktop, has never been backed up in a way anyone tested, and would take the business with it if that machine died. Fixing that is usually a same-day job.

And the same data gets typed twice, out of the point of sale or the job system and into QuickBooks by hand. That is often connectable, and it is where the hours actually go.

Frequently asked

Do you do bookkeeping?

No. We handle the technical side and work alongside whoever does your books. If you do not have anyone, we can point you at local bookkeepers, but we will not do the accounting ourselves.

Should I move to QuickBooks Online?

Depends. Online is easier to reach from anywhere and back up. Desktop is faster on large files and some industry features only exist there. We will give you a straight recommendation for your situation rather than push the subscription.

My file is huge and slow. Do I have to start over?

Usually not. Slowness is often the file needing maintenance, or the hosting setup, or the machine. Starting a new file loses history and is a last resort.

Can several people use it at once?

Yes, with the right licensing and hosting configuration. Done wrong it locks users out and can corrupt the file, which is the situation we get called into most often.

Is my company file backed up right now?

If nobody has restored from it recently, treat the answer as no. That is the single most common gap we find and it is the one that can end a business.
